Elsie Emily Clark 1901–1993 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 3 January 1901

Birth Location: Promise, Wallowa County, Oregon, United States of America

Death Date: 12 July 1993

Death Location: Oregon City, Clackamas County, Oregon, United States of America

Father: Ward Clark

Mother: Emily Clark

Spouse(s): Alfred Schambron

Children(s): Marie Schambron, Florene Peck, Duane Schambron

In 1901, Elsie Emily Clark entered the world in Promise, Wallowa County, Oregon, United States of America, born to Ward Nathaniel Clark And Emily K Clark. Elsie Emily Clark married Alfred R Schambron, and had children including Duane A Schambron, Florene June Peck, Marie Lavelle Schambron. Elsie Emily Clark passed away in 1993 in Oregon City, Clackamas County, Oregon, United States of America.
